Strengthen relationship between AASL National and State Affiliates

Timeline Event

June 2014 New Strategic Plan- Goal: Grow and strengthen AASL’s community- specifically the relationship with state affiliates

MW 2015 Facilitated Harwood Exercise: Asking the state affiliates what their aspirations were for the affiliate assembly

Annual 2015 Leadership Conference- content developed from MW Harwood material

MW 2016 New Affiliate Assembly structure developed- to include an aspiration exercise

Annual 2016 Continued “mini” Leadership Conference and follow-up Harwood exercise based on MW15 outcomes

Strengthen relationship between AASL National and State Affiliates

Outcomes:1) AASL and Affiliate become stronger2) Leaders will rise faster3) Concerns will be addressed earlier and have greater impact.

MOST IMPORTANT: As Affiliates are given additional tools and resources (they ask for through their ‘aspirations’) the services they offer to school librarians within their state expands and AASL’s mission to empower leaders to transform teaching and learning is met.
